当前位置 主页 > 技术大全 >

    xshell怎么上传文件,在xshell上传文件怎么应对

    栏目:技术大全 时间:2024-12-16 18:08

        Xshell作为一款功能强大的远程连接工具,不仅支持管理服务器,还能够通过内置的SFTP功能实现文件的上传与下载。在日常工作中,将本地文件上传到服务器是常见操作,但对于刚接触Xshell的用户来说,具体操作步骤可能不够清晰。那么,Xshell怎么上传文件呢?具体步骤如下。
        以下是使用Xshell上传文件到服务器的详细步骤:
        1.启动Xshell并连接服务器
        -打开Xshell,选择目标会话并连接到服务器。确保连接正常,能够访问服务器目录。
        2.打开SFTP窗口
        -在Xshell主界面,点击工具栏中的“SFTP”按钮,或者在底部命令行输入`sftp`指令并按回车键,打开SFTP窗口。
        3.上传文件到服务器
        -在SFTP窗口中,定位到本地文件所在的路径。
        -使用`put`命令将文件上传到服务器,例如:
        ```
        putC:\Users\YourName\Desktop\file.txt/home/your_user/
        ```
        这里,`file.txt`是本地文件,`/home/your_user/`是服务器目标目录。
        4.批量上传文件
        -若需要一次性上传多个文件,可以使用通配符,例如:
        ```
        putC:\Users\YourName\Desktop\*.txt/home/your_user/
        ```
        这将上传路径中所有的`.txt`文件。
        5.验证上传结果
        -文件上传完成后,可以在SFTP窗口中使用`ls`命令查看服务器目录,确认文件已成功上传。
        6.关闭SFTP窗口
        -完成上传任务后,输入`exit`退出SFTP模式,返回到Xshell的主窗口。
        尽管Xshell的SFTP功能能够完成文件上传,但其操作依赖命令行,对于习惯图形界面的用户可能略显不便。此时,IIS7服务器管理工具成为一个更简便的选择,它通过直观的界面,让用户能够更高效地完成文件上传和服务器管理工作。
        以下是通过IIS7服务器管理工具上传文件的步骤:
        一、启动工具并连接服务器
        1.打开IIS7服务器管理工具,添加服务器信息后,连接目标服务器。
        二、进入文件管理界面
        1.在工具主界面中,点击“文件管理”选项,进入上传/下载界面。
        三、选择文件并上传
        1.点击“上传文件”按钮,浏览并选择本地文件。
        2.确定目标服务器的存储路径后,点击“确认上传”,工具会自动将文件传输到指定位置。
        四、批量上传文件
        1.如果需要上传多个文件,可以直接选择整个文件夹,工具会自动处理批量上传任务。
        五、验证上传结果
        1.上传完成后,可以通过工具的文件管理界面查看目标服务器的文件状态,确认上传是否成功。


        通过本文的介绍,您已经了解了如何使用Xshell的SFTP功能上传文件,Xshell提供了简单的SFTP命令行功能,适合熟悉命令操作的用户。但对于需要频繁上传文件的场景,IIS7服务器管理工具的图形化界面显然更高效,无需记忆复杂命令,上传操作更加直观便捷。特别是在处理批量文件上传时,IIS7工具能够显著提升效率。